1994 Ford Tracer vs. 2011 Honda Accord
To start off, 2011 Honda Accord is newer by 17 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1994 Ford Tracer.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1994 Ford Tracer would be higher. At 3,500 cc (6 cylinders), 2011 Honda Accord is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Honda Accord (271 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 190 more horse power than 1994 Ford Tracer. (81 HP @ 5500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Honda Accord should accelerate faster than 1994 Ford Tracer.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2011 Honda Accord weights approximately 537 kg more than 1994 Ford Tracer.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Honda Accord (340 Nm @ 5000 RPM) has 220 more torque (in Nm) than 1994 Ford Tracer. (120 Nm @ 3800 RPM). This means 2011 Honda Accord will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1994 Ford Tracer.
